The deck is the group of cards or cards that are used to develop various games or hobbies. A letter or playing card, for its part, is a piece of cardboard, generally rectangular in format, that has a uniform illustration on one side and that has a certain figure stamped with a number on the other.

For some games it is necessary to use a complete deck while, in others, it is customary to leave some unused cards out of play, as can occur with jokers. Some games even require the use of at least two decks.

Types of decks

It should be noted that there are various types of decks to cover multiple game possibilities. The so-called Spanish deck , for example, usually consists of 48 cards and a pair of jokers. The 48 cards are divided into four suits ( swords , gold , cups and clubs ) and are numbered from 1 to 12, with 10 ( jack ), 11 ( knight ) and 12 ( king ) as figures.

The English deck , for its part, presents 52 cards that are segmented into four suits ( hearts , clubs , diamonds and spades ) and which are numbered from 2 to 10, followed by the J , the Q and the A (the ace, which equals 1). Generally, hearts and diamonds are represented in a reddish tone, while clubs and spades are drawn in black.

Different games

There are many card games that use these decks. Thus, for example, the Spanish call is used to have fun with the brisca , the cinquillo , the mus , the burro , the tute or the forty .

In the case of the English deck of cards, one of the games that use it and that are most famous worldwide is poker , which in recent years has experienced a significant increase in its fans. Persian and German games seem to have been the origins of the aforementioned poker, which consists of players, with their cards partially or completely hidden, making bets.

The one with the highest score is the one who will be the winner in each game and to achieve this you can count on various possible combinations and classifications of cards such as the straight flush, the poker of aces, the full house, the royal flush, the double couples or trio, among others.

It is important to highlight that this game has a large number of variants, including closed, open, assortment or shared card poker.

The tarot deck

The deck used in the practice of tarot , on the other hand, is more numerous: it is made up of 78 cards, of which 22 are major arcana, 40 correspond to minor arcana and the remaining 16 are identified with figures or honors.

The minor arcana and figures, for their part, are divided into four suits (swords, gold, cups and wands), similar to those of the Spanish deck.

Other uses of the term

The notion of deck, on the other hand, is also used to name a range of possibilities, options or alternatives . For example: “The technical director has a wide deck of forwards to form his starting lineup.”
